Xining, April 30 (Sun Rui) Qinghai Province's Mangya City Bureau of Culture, Sports, Tourism, Radio, Film and Television released on the 30th that Obo liang Yadan, located in the Qaidam Basin, was officially opened to the public on May Day, welcoming tourists from inside and outside the province to come and feel the most Mars-like place on earth.

Located in Haixi Prefecture, Qinghai Province, in the Qaidam Basin of Qinghai Province, the Oboliang Yadan landform has a Yadan landform formed 75 million years ago, with a total area of about 21,500 square kilometers, which is the largest wind erosion forest group found in China so far, and one of the largest and most typical Yadan landscapes in the world. Among them, the most distinctive is Obolyn Yadan, with an average altitude of 3260 meters.

It is understood that the formation of the Oboliang Yadan landform group stems from the uplift of the Qinghai-Tibet Plateau and the continuous wind erosion after the ancient seabed dried up. The Obolyn Yadan landform group often generates a mysterious wind sound due to the peculiar terrain, coupled with the fact that the local rocks are rich in iron and the geomagnetism is strong, which is easy to make the compass fail, resulting in pedestrians unable to distinguish the direction and get lost, and is known as "Devil's City" by the world, also known as "the most Mars-like place on Earth".

On the mountain beams of the Oboliang Yadan landform group, there are various forms of Yadan landscape such as turtle back shape, groove ridge type, round hill type, column type, etc., forming a natural Yadan "art museum".

According to the relevant person in charge of the Bureau of Culture, Sports, Tourism, Radio, Film and Television of Mangya City, Qinghai Province, in order to enrich the tourism products of the Qaidam section of the Qinggan Ring Road during the "May Day Holiday", Lenghu Oboliang Yadan was officially opened to the public to welcome the sightseeing experience of the majority of tourists. During the opening period, vehicles will be restricted from entering the core area, and tourists will enter, and tickets will be waived for the time being. At the same time, the scenic spot intends to permanently waive tickets for medical personnel, military/armed police, fire officers and soldiers, science fiction writers, Qinghai tourists, and Zhejiang tourists.
